Heart of a Dog: Laurie Anderson's film on love and loss
Internationally renowned musician and performance artist Laurie Anderson has made a new film centred on her beloved rat terrier, Lolabelle, who died four years ago.
At times the story in Heart of a Dog unfolds through her pet's point of view, in what she describes as ''a collection of short stories about love and death''.
